Transaction a8fa4bf1c7705950631a467e956aba28563975ada05ec9ffae23765bebe341df
1 Input
1 Output
-
a8fa4bf1c7705950631a467e956aba28563975ada05ec9ffae23765bebe341df:0
- value
- 16899059
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 19ed76ea50ceae9bec06c143cf4e51e150d47745 OP_EQUAL
- address
- 3447HfQzacnvmkhAiZwWKSXEZ6xwwaZsVx